Understanding Engine Oil and Viscosity
Learning what your engine actually requires can help you prevent premature engine wear. Modern vehicles typically require synthetic blends. Full synthetic oil provides superior protection under extreme heat. Conversely, conventional oil breaks down faster but remains acceptable for engines specifically designed for it.
The most common mistake at the oil change shop occurs when drivers don’t know their manufacturer’s specification. A honest oil change technician will check your owner’s manual specification. Always ask to see the new oil level on the dipstick before driving away.

Are Dealerships Better Than Quick Lubes?
For routine fluid maintenance in Houston, the choice between a dealership and an independent inspection & lube often comes down to time. An operation like HouTx Oil & Inspection service is built specifically to cycle vehicles through quickly, often keeping you in the driver’s seat. Conversely, dropping a car at a dealership usually requires an appointment and surrendering the vehicle for half the day. As long as the independent shop uses the manufacturer-specified oil weight (like a 0W-20 full synthetic) and a quality filter, your factory warranty remains 100% legally intact due to the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act.
The Danger of Extended Drain Intervals
Automakers increasingly advertise extreme 10,000-mile or 15,000-mile oil change intervals. However, mechanics across Houston routinely warn against pushing oil this far. A inspection & lube like HouTx Oil & Inspection service will tell you that while the synthetic oil itself might survive 10,000 miles, the tiny paper oil filter often breaks down and goes into ‘bypass mode’ long before that, meaning dirty, unfiltered oil is circulating through your engine. Changing your oil and filter every 5,000 to 7,500 miles remains the absolute cheapest, most effective insurance policy you can buy for your vehicle’s longevity.
The Importance of Tire Pressure Checks
An underrated benefit of visiting a professional inspection & lube like HouTx Oil & Inspection service in Houston is the complimentary tire pressure check. Temperature fluctuations directly impact tire pressure-for every 10-degree drop in outside temperature, your tires lose 1 PSI. Underinflated tires not only reduce your fuel economy by forcing the engine to work harder, but they dramatically alter your vehicle’s braking distance and handling characteristics in the rain. A thorough lube tech will inflate your tires precisely to the specifications listed on your driver’s side door jamb, not the maximum pressure stamped on the tire sidewall.
Frequently Asked Questions
How often do I really need an oil change?
The old rule of “3 months or 3,000 miles” is largely a myth perpetuated by quick lubes to increase frequency. Most modern vehicles using full synthetic oil can safely travel between 5,000 and 10,000 miles between changes. Always resort to the vehicle’s internal oil life monitoring system. However, if you do a lot of short stop-and-go trips, you should follow the “severe duty” schedule, which is usually around 5,000 miles.
Can I switch back to conventional oil after using synthetic?
Yes, transitioning between synthetic and conventional oil is perfectly safe, provided your vehicle does not explicitly require full synthetic oil from the factory. The myth that switching back causes engine seals to leak is based on outdated oil chemistries from the 1970s. However, if you switch back to conventional, you must monitor your oil level more closely.
